If you checkout on aee02594be68a968bb843f87d3264777099e46b4 you still have this vulnerable code:

(define (run-browser uri)
  (system
   (if (getenv "BROWSER")
       (format #f "~a ~a" (getenv "BROWSER") uri)
       (format #f "firefox -remote 'OpenURL(~a,new-tab)'" uri))))

Don Armstrong - 2018-05-11

I have just uploaded a fix to Debian which switches to using system* instead of system:
https://salsa.debian.org/debian/lilypond/commit/788b56e4b7f62637481af65b4b2929649c30fe78

Not sure if this is cross-platform enough, but it solves the issue for systems with a working system* call.
